Tragedy on the Hudson: Understanding the Impact of Helicopter Crashes and Safety Measures

On Thursday, tragedy struck the Hudson River when a helicopter crashed, resulting in at least one confirmed death and multiple injuries. This incident raises important questions about aviation safety, emergency response, and regulatory measures concerning air traffic in densely populated urban areas. Understanding the gravity of such events can help us prepare for and mitigate the impact of future incidents, promoting a safer environment for both aviation and community living.

The crash unfolded at approximately 15:15 EDT, and although two individuals were rescued from the water, their condition remains uncertain. The New York Police Department reports that emergency response teams, including marine and land units, arrived promptly on the scene. In this case, the helicopter went down near Pier 40, close to the New Jersey side of the river. The ensuing chaos impacted not only those involved but also the surrounding community, as boat traffic and street traffic were halted.
